Synopsis of Braque, 1882-1963

Este libro explora la vida y obra de Georges Braque, un influyente pintor y escultor francés nacido en 1882 y fallecido en 1963. Braque es conocido por ser uno de los pioneros del cubismo, junto con Pablo Picasso, y por su importante contribución al desarrollo del arte moderno. El libro ofrece una visión detallada de su trayectoria artística, desde sus primeras obras hasta sus últimas creaciones, destacando su estilo único y su impacto en el mundo del arte.

About the author

Georges Braque

Georges Braque

Georges Braque was a major 20th-century French painter, collagist, draughtsman, printmaker and sculptor. His most notable contributions were in his alliance with Fauvism from 1905, and the role he played in the development of Cubism. Braque's work between 1908 and 1912 is closely associated with that of his colleague Pablo Picasso. Their respective Cubist works were indistinguishable for many years, yet the quiet nature of Braque was partially eclipsed by the fame and notoriety of Picasso.
